Transaction 596a88f8597fbcce6daba0bad55d3bc20e5b23d947ce881ea89f6ab335cd7746
1 Input
1 Output
-
596a88f8597fbcce6daba0bad55d3bc20e5b23d947ce881ea89f6ab335cd7746:0
- value
- 683220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 92efd015e23d67034fb65557c6340943010ef948 OP_EQUAL
- address
- 3F5ws3Coj9qRaPErZWFtNo4bY3bEVzksma